Tesla Inc TSLA shares are trading higher by 3.09% to $229.28 Wednesday afternoon after falling earlier in the week on China price cuts.
What Happened?
Tesla has lowered the starting prices for its Model 3 and Model Y vehicles in China. The Model 3 sedan was reduced to 265,900 yuan ($36,612) from 279,900 yuan. The Model Y SUV now costs 288,900 yuan ($39,779), which is down from the previous price of 316,900 yuan.

Tesla last week also reported third-quarter revenue of $21.45 billion, up 56% year-over-year. The total came in shy of analyst estimates of $21.96 billion. The company reported automotive revenue of $18.69 billion in the third quarter, up 55% year-over-year.
